1. Individuals Struggling with Clutter and Disorganization
-
For individuals battling clutter and disorganization in waking life, garbage places in dreams might symbolize their internal feelings of chaos, overwhelm, and disarray.
-
The accumulation of waste and discarded items can parallel the buildup of unresolved issues, emotions, and tasks that weigh heavily on their minds.
-
The dream could be a manifestation of the dreamer's desire to clear out the mental clutter and create a more organized and harmonious inner landscape.
-
Alternatively, the garbage place might represent a specific area in the dreamer's life that they feel is messy and out of control, such as their home, workspace, or relationships.
-
The dream may be urging them to address and resolve these issues in order to restore order and balance.
-
The condition of the garbage place in the dream can provide further insights.
-
A filthy, overflowing dump might reflect feelings of extreme overwhelm and a sense that the dreamer is drowning in their problems.
-
A more organized and manageable garbage disposal site could indicate that the dreamer is making progress in addressing their clutter and disorganization.
2. People Experiencing Emotional Turmoil or Chaos
-
Emotional upheaval: Dreaming of a garbage place can signify intense emotional turmoil or chaos in the dreamer's life. The overpowering smell, unsightly mess, and sense of disarray in the dream world mirror the overwhelming emotions and confusion the dreamer feels in the waking world.
-
Feeling overwhelmed: A garbage place can symbolize feeling overwhelmed by life's challenges. The sheer volume of waste and debris in the dream can represent the accumulation of unresolved issues, burdens, and stressors that weigh heavily on the dreamer's mind.
-
Loss of control: The chaotic and disorganized nature of a garbage place can reflect a sense of loss of control in the dreamer's life. They may feel like their circumstances are spiraling out of control and that they are unable to regain stability.
-
Seeking clarity and order: The act of sorting through garbage in a dream can symbolize the dreamer's desire to bring clarity and order into their life. They may be seeking ways to declutter their physical and emotional spaces and regain a sense of balance and control.
-
Emotional release: Sometimes, dreaming of a garbage place can be a form of emotional release. The act of discarding and letting go of waste in the dream can represent the dreamer's attempt to release pent-up emotions, negative thoughts, or past experiences that have been weighing them down.

4. Individuals Struggling with Guilt or Shame
For individuals grappling with guilt or shame, dreamscapes can provide a stark reflection of their inner turmoil.
Garbage places, characterized by overflowing bins, rotting debris, and pungent odors, often emerge as symbolic representations of this emotional burden.
The accumulation of refuse mirrors the weight of unresolved issues pressing down on the dreamer's psyche.
The garbage itself becomes a metaphor for the feelings of worthlessness, inadequacy, and self-loathing that gnaw at their core.
The overpowering stench emanating from the garbage place serves as a reminder of the toxicity of these emotions, permeating every aspect of their waking life.
These dreams often manifest as the dreamer finding themselves trapped amidst this squalid environment, unable to escape the suffocating weight of their guilt or shame.
The overwhelming sense of disgust and revulsion they feel towards the garbage reflects their self-contempt and the desire to purge these negative emotions from their being.
Alternatively, the garbage place may appear as a distant, looming presence, a symbol of the dreamer's fear of being exposed or of their past catching up with them.
The act of scavenging through the garbage, searching for something of value, could represent the dreamer's desperate attempts to find meaning or worth amidst their feelings of self-loathing.
Understanding the symbolism of garbage places in dreams can provide valuable insights into the emotional struggles of individuals burdened by guilt or shame.
It encourages them to confront these difficult emotions, seek support, and embark on a journey of self-acceptance and healing.
5. Those Experiencing Loss or Grief
-
For those experiencing loss or grief, garbage places in dreams can symbolize the emotional purging and letting go of the past.
-
The act of discarding items in a garbage place can represent the release of pent-up emotions, painful memories, or material possessions associated with the loss.
-
The dream may be encouraging the dreamer to declutter their emotional and physical space to make room for healing and new beginnings.
-
The presence of specific items in the garbage place can offer clues about the specific aspects of the loss or grief that the dreamer is struggling with.
-
Dreams of garbage places can be a way for the subconscious to process and come to terms with the finality of death or the end of a relationship.
-
The dream may also be a reminder to let go of material possessions and focus on the emotional and spiritual aspects of life.
-
If the garbage place is particularly chaotic or overwhelming, it may indicate feelings of being overwhelmed by grief or the need for emotional support.
6. People Dealing with Environmental Issues or Pollution Concerns
For those actively involved in addressing environmental issues or pollution concerns, dreams of garbage places can hold deep significance. These dreams may reflect their profound emotional responses to the state of the planet and their dedication to creating positive change.
Environmentalists and pollution control advocates often experience heightened sensitivity to the harmful effects of pollution and waste on the environment. When these concerns occupy their waking thoughts, they may manifest in their dreams as garbage places, symbolizing the accumulation of toxic substances and the degradation of natural landscapes.
These dreams can serve as a mirror, reflecting the dreamer's inner turmoil and frustration over the seemingly insurmountable challenges they face in their environmental work. The garbage place represents the accumulation of unresolved issues, the weight of responsibility, and the urgency to find solutions to pressing environmental problems.
Moreover, such dreams may symbolize the dreamer's feelings of powerlessness and despair in the face of overwhelming environmental degradation. The garbage place becomes a metaphor for the overwhelming task of cleaning up the mess created by human activities and the seemingly endless battle against pollution.
Paradoxically, these dreams can also represent a source of hope and determination. The dreamer's presence in the garbage place suggests their willingness to confront the challenges and take action towards creating positive change. The act of cleaning up or transforming the garbage place in the dream symbolizes the dreamer's commitment to making a difference and their belief in the possibility of a cleaner and healthier planet.
Ultimately, for those dedicated to environmental issues, dreams of garbage places provide a glimpse into their inner struggles, their passion for change, and their unwavering commitment to protecting the planet. These dreams serve as a reminder of the importance of their work and the need for continued perseverance in the face of adversity.
